Sri Lanka · electricity network
Sri Lanka power grid
OverWatts maps 969 km of Sri Lanka's electricity transmission network across 53 line segments and 0 substations, the 112th most-mapped grid of 153 countries. Its backbone is high voltage (220–379 kV), carrying 969 km — 100% of the mapped length, with the highest tagged voltage at 220 kV. That works out to 14.8 km per 1,000 km² of land — moderate OpenStreetMap coverage, ahead of 48% of mapped countries. No cross-border capacity is recorded today; 500 MW is planned.
OpenStreetMap coverage
This grades how completely OpenStreetMap has drawn Sri Lanka's network — not how much network exists. Large, sparsely-populated countries score low for geographic reasons alone, and every kilometre here is mapped length, so the totals are a floor rather than an operator-reported figure. 2% of segments carry a real line name and 53% an operator tag.

Cross-border links from Sri Lanka
- India500 MW · planned
0 MW existing · 500 MW planned · capacities from the Global Transmission Database v0.1 (CC BY 4.0), existing as of 2023
